Searching for or using a "crackeado" version of professional software like PRO-Elétrica presents significant dangers:
Lack of Support and Updates: Legitimate software vendors provide customer support, updates, and patches. Users of cracked software do not have access to these services, which can lead to unresolved technical issues and vulnerabilities that are not patched.
